* Job Responsibilities:

*** Collaborate to design, develop, and implement corporate preventative and predictive maintenance systems using IBM Maximo.
* Implement and optimize cost-justified Predictive and Preventative Maintenance Strategies and Reliability Best Practices at the plant
* Provide necessary CMMS related training to end users, adhering to the Maximo SOP.
* Continuously improve the Electrical and Mechanical Preventative Maintenance system to enhance safety, product quality, production efficiency, and labor/material effectiveness.
* Analyze production losses due to downtime, rate reduction, and waste of critical equipment to prioritize Root Cause Analysis efforts.
* Review downtime data to identify trends and recurring failures, aiding in root cause identification.
* Facilitate RCM, using FMECA’s to assess criticality ranking of existing failure modes, identify and design out the root causes of defects and develop predictive and preventive strategies to reduce impact  or detect defects early enough to correct before an unplanned failure.
* Assess and optimize the spare parts required to support the critical PM tasks developed from RCM.
* Evaluate and justify new technologies or inspection procedures to replace current instrumentation controls, sensors, drives, and other electrical components and inspection strategies.
* Other related reliability and maintenance responsibilities.

* Qualifications:

*** University degree in Engineering (preferably in Electrical, Mechanical or Reliability Engineering)
* Minimum 3 years of experience in process manufacturing or industrial equipment design environments (Preferably with Maintenance)
* Understanding electrical standards such as: IEEE, National Electric Code, NEMA, etc. is an asset
* Proficiency in MS Excel, AutoCAD, and CMMS (Maximo would be an asset)
* Proven problem solver with various methodologies
* Familiar with the Workflow from service requests to the final close out of Work Orders
* Experience with plant planning and scheduling, shutdown procedures and best practices
* Willingness to travel occasionally within North America for training and/or assist at other IKO Plants
* Previously developed PM, PdM strategies and Best Practices for high speed manufacturing equipment
* Worked with condition monitoring equipment such as: vibration analysis, ultrasonic lube, belt tensioners, etc. As well as precision installation tools such as:
Laser alignment, sonic belt tensioners, etc.
